The Effects of Hard Water on Your Plumbing System
Hard water, an usual problem in several homes, can have considerable influence on pipes systems. Understanding these effects is important for preserving the longevity and efficiency of your pipelines and components.

Introduction


Tough water is water that contains high levels of liquified minerals, mostly calcium and magnesium. These minerals are safe to human health and wellness however can ruin plumbing infrastructure with time. Let's explore how tough water affects pipes and what you can do regarding it.

Impacts on Pipes


Tough water influences pipes in a number of destructive means, largely through scale build-up, reduced water flow, and raised corrosion.

Range Buildup


Among the most common concerns caused by difficult water is scale accumulation inside pipes and fixtures. As water streams through the pipes system, minerals precipitate out and stick to the pipe walls. In time, this buildup can tighten pipe openings, resulting in minimized water flow and raised stress on the system.

Lowered Water Flow


Natural resources from tough water can progressively reduce the diameter of pipelines, restricting water circulation to taps, showers, and devices. This decreased circulation not only impacts water stress but likewise raises power usage as home appliances like hot water heater have to function harder to supply the very same amount of hot water.

What is Hard Water?


Difficult water is characterized by its mineral content, particularly calcium and magnesium ions. These minerals go into the water supply as it percolates through limestone and chalk deposits underground. When hard water is heated or entrusted to stand, it often tends to create range, a crusty accumulation that abides by surface areas and can trigger a range of issues in plumbing systems.

Corrosion


While tough water minerals themselves do not trigger corrosion, they can intensify existing deterioration problems in pipes. Range build-up can catch water against steel surfaces, accelerating the deterioration procedure and potentially resulting in leaks or pipeline failing over time.

Appliance Damages


Beyond pipes, difficult water can likewise harm house home appliances attached to the water system. Appliances such as water heaters, dishwashers, and cleaning machines are especially vulnerable to scale buildup. This can reduce their effectiveness, boost upkeep prices, and shorten their life expectancy.

Expenses of Hard Water


The financial ramifications of tough water extend past plumbing repair services to include boosted energy expenses and premature home appliance replacement.

Repair work Prices


Handling tough water-related issues can be expensive, especially if range build-up leads to pipeline or home appliance failure. Normal upkeep and early detection of issues can aid mitigate these prices.

Routine Upkeep


Frequently purging the pipes system and checking for scale buildup can help prevent costly repair services down the line. Routine checks of home appliances for indications of range accumulation are likewise crucial.

Picking the Right Fixtures


Opting for pipes fixtures and devices developed to hold up against hard water conditions can mitigate its impacts. Search for products with corrosion-resistant materials and easy-clean features to decrease upkeep needs.

Power Efficiency


Scale accumulation minimizes the performance of water heaters and other home appliances, bring about higher power usage. By addressing tough water concerns promptly, property owners can improve energy efficiency and decrease utility bills.

Testing and Treatment


Evaluating for hard water and implementing suitable treatment procedures is vital to alleviating its impacts on pipes and appliances.

Water Conditioners


Water softeners are one of the most usual service for dealing with tough water. They function by exchanging calcium and magnesium ions with sodium or potassium ions, successfully minimizing the hardness of the water.

Other Therapy Options


In addition to water conditioners, various other therapy alternatives consist of magnetic water conditioners, reverse osmosis systems, and chemical ingredients. Each technique has its advantages and suitability depending upon the severity of the difficult water trouble and family demands.

Preventive Measures


Avoiding hard water damage calls for a mix of positive maintenance and thoughtful fixture option.

Final thought


In conclusion, the influences of difficult water on pipelines and home appliances are considerable but convenient with appropriate understanding and preventive measures. By recognizing just how hard water impacts your pipes system and taking positive steps to alleviate its effects, you can prolong the life of your pipelines, boost energy performance, and decrease maintenance costs in the future.

The Impact of Hard water on Your Plumbing and Appliances


One of the most common issues associated with hard water is scale buildup. Scale is a hard, crusty deposit that forms on the inside of pipes and plumbing fixtures due to the minerals in hard water. Over time, these deposits can accumulate and cause a range of problems for your plumbing system.



How scale buildup affects plumbing and water pressure



As scale continues to accumulate inside your pipes, it narrows the passage through which water can flow. This makes it increasingly difficult for water to pass through, leading to a number of problems that can affect your home’s plumbing system.



Slow drains are a common issue associated with scale buildup. As the pipe diameter narrows, water has a harder time draining, which can result in slow-moving drains and even standing water in sinks and bathtubs.



Reduced water pressure in showers and faucets is another consequence of scale accumulation. As the buildup restricts water flow, less water is able to pass through your pipes at any given time. This leads to weak water pressure in your showers and faucets, making everyday tasks like washing your hands or taking a shower less enjoyable and effective.



Clogged pipes are perhaps the most severe problem that can arise from scale buildup. In extreme cases, the accumulated scale can completely obstruct the passage of water through the pipe, resulting in a total blockage. This can cause backups in your plumbing system, potentially leading to costly repairs and even water damage to your home.


Corrosion and damage to fixtures



The minerals present in hard water, primarily calcium and magnesium, can react with metal surfaces, causing a variety of problems that can impact the performance and appearance of your fixtures.



One of the primary ways that hard water causes damage to fixtures is through the formation of rust and other types of corrosion. When the minerals in hard water come into contact with metal surfaces, they can react chemically, leading to the formation of rust, tarnish, or other corrosive substances. This not only affects the appearance of the fixtures, causing discoloration and staining, but can also weaken the fixtures over time.



Furthermore, the constant exposure to hard water can cause seals and washers within your fixtures to wear out more quickly, potentially leading to leaks and other malfunctions. As these components become worn or damaged, they may no longer provide an effective seal, allowing water to leak out around the edges of the fixture, potentially causing water damage to surrounding areas.



Hard water can have a significant impact on your plumbing fixtures, causing corrosion, damage, and reduced functionality. By addressing hard water issues in your home, you can help to protect your fixtures from these problems, ensuring they remain functional and visually appealing for years to come.



The Impact of Hard Water on Appliances



Reduced efficiency and lifespan




Hard water can have a significant impact on the efficiency and lifespan of your appliances. The scale buildup caused by hard water can clog or damage various components, leading to decreased performance and increased energy consumption. Appliances that use water, such as dishwashers, washing machines, and water heaters, are particularly susceptible to hard water damage.



The lifespan of your appliances can also be shortened by hard water. Scale buildup can cause increased wear and tear on components, leading to more frequent breakdowns and a shorter overall lifespan. By addressing hard water issues, you can help to extend the life of your appliances and save money on repairs and replacements.



Dishwashers and hard water



Dishwashers are especially vulnerable to the effects of hard water. Scale buildup can cause poor water circulation, leading to dishes that are not properly cleaned. Additionally, the minerals in hard water can leave unsightly spots and streaks on glassware and other dishes. Regular maintenance and the use of water softeners can help to mitigate these issues and keep your dishwasher running smoothly. Learn how to clean and maintain your dishwasher.



Washing machines and hard water



Hard water can also impact the performance of your washing machine. Scale buildup can clog the water inlet valve, leading to reduced water flow and decreased cleaning efficiency. Hard water can also cause detergent to be less effective, resulting in dingy, stiff, and scratchy clothing. By addressing hard water issues, you can ensure that your washing machine continues to provide optimal performance and extend its lifespan.



Water heaters and hard water



Water heaters are particularly susceptible to the negative effects of hard water, as they are in constant contact with water and have internal components that can be damaged by scale buildup. The accumulation of scale inside the water heater can lead to reduced efficiency, higher energy bills, and decreased hot water availability. Moreover, scale buildup can cause increased wear on the heating element, shortening its lifespan and potentially leading to costly repairs or replacements.



One of the key components within a water heater that is particularly vulnerable to hard water damage is the anode rod. The anode rod is a sacrificial component designed to corrode in place of the water heater’s tank, thereby extending its life. However, hard water can cause the anode rod to corrode more quickly than intended, leading to a decreased lifespan for both the rod and the water heater as a whole. Regular inspection and replacement of the anode rod can help ensure that it continues to protect your water heater from corrosion.



To protect your water heater from the damaging effects of hard water, it is important to implement regular maintenance procedures and consider using water softeners. Regular maintenance, such as flushing the water heater to remove sediment and scale buildup, can help maintain its efficiency and prolong its lifespan. This process involves draining the water from the tank and flushing it with fresh water to remove any accumulated sediment and scale
